Melodifestivalen 2025:  Sweden's national final is called Melodifestivalen and is the biggest one in the world of the Eurovision Song Contest. It is the 65th edition and is produced by Swedish broadcaster SVT. 30 entries out of 2794 submitted songs made it to the shows. The 30 entries will take part in the competition across five heats. Each heat consists of six songs, with the top two songs directly qualifying for the final. Unlike in the previous edition, only the third-placing song will proceed to a final qualification round at the end of the fifth heat, which will now feature five songs instead of ten. Two songs in the final qualification will then progress to the final, which will comprise of 12 songs. The winner of the final will be determined by the usual 50/50 combination of votes from the public and an international jury. All shows are hosted by Edvin Törnblom and Kristina Petrushina.The dates and locations of the shows is shown below:

Heat 1 on 01 Feb 2025 in Luleå
Heat 2 on 08 Feb 2025 in Gothenburg
Heat 3 on 15 Feb 2025 in Västerås
Heat 4 on 22 Feb 2025 in Malmö
Heat 5 on 01 Mar 2025 in Jönköping
Grand Final on 08 Mar 2025 in Stockhoplm's Strawberry (Friends) Arena

Melodifestivalen 2025 - Heat 4 in Malmö in Sweden (22 Feb 2025) - Complete Coverage

 


Melodifestivalen is Sweden's selection process to find that song that will represent Sweden at the Eurovision Song Contest. Out of 2794 submitted songs 30 entries are being distributed into 5 heats out of which two songs advance to the Grand Final of Melodifestivalen 2025 in the Strawberry (Friends) Arena on 08 May 2025 and out of each heat 1 song is selected to Final Qualification or second chance round. From that two songs join the ten winners from the heats to have a Grand Final of 12 songs the winner of which will be representing Sweden at the Eurovision Song Contest 2025 in Basel, Switzerland.

This week Radio International's Interview Team JP and John Dawton are being joined via SKYPE once again by Andreas Lundstedt and Lina Hedlund who both were part of the group Alcazar. One of Alcazar's biggest successes was the world hit from 2002 "Crying at the Discoteque". But also the last entry of Alcazar at Sweden's Melodifestivalen was back in 2014 when Lina, Andreas and Tess as Alcazar made it successfully to the Grand Final with "Blame it on the Disco". As a surprise to the artists Tess Merkel "gatecrashed" the interview session to the surprise of  Lina and Andreas. Radio International reunited Swedish Band Alcazar during the interview session in the show today. 

Andreas Lundstedt was also part of the 2006 Swiss Eurovision entry called Six 4 One who performed the song "If we all give a little" written and penned by German Composer Ralph Siegel.

Lina Hedlund entered Melodifestivalen a few times with the last entry being in 2019 with the song "Victorious" which was written by Dotter and in 2020 Lina co-hosted Melodifestivalen together with David Sundin and Linnea Henriksson.

Tess Merkel, the third member of the former group Alcazar is part of the artist line-up for Melodifestivalen 2021.
